Thing Fish, though to be fair I've only ever heard bits of Francesco Zappa and highly unimpressive it was too.

Joe's Garage has some excellent material on it, particularly on disc 2, but the narration gets a bit tiresome after the first couple of spins.

The second half of Studio Tan is excellent, but I generally skip Greggary Peccary although even that has some excellent arrangements.

The sequence of albums that started with Tinsel Town Rebellion was his low point IMO, a series of slick but uninspired live/studio hybrids from about '79 to '84, although the Guitar album shows that even then he was capable of producing the goods when he wanted to.
